xref: /aosp_15_r20/external/perfetto/src/trace_processor/perfetto_sql/grammar/perfettosql_grammar.h (revision 6dbdd20afdafa5e3ca9b8809fa73465d530080dc)
1 #define TK_CREATE 1
2 #define TK_REPLACE 2
3 #define TK_PERFETTO 3
4 #define TK_MACRO 4
5 #define TK_INCLUDE 5
6 #define TK_MODULE 6
7 #define TK_RETURNS 7
8 #define TK_FUNCTION 8
9 #define TK_OR 9
10 #define TK_AND 10
11 #define TK_NOT 11
12 #define TK_IS 12
13 #define TK_MATCH 13
14 #define TK_LIKE_KW 14
15 #define TK_BETWEEN 15
16 #define TK_IN 16
17 #define TK_ISNULL 17
18 #define TK_NOTNULL 18
19 #define TK_NE 19
20 #define TK_EQ 20
21 #define TK_GT 21
22 #define TK_LE 22
23 #define TK_LT 23
24 #define TK_GE 24
25 #define TK_ESCAPE 25
26 #define TK_BITAND 26
27 #define TK_BITOR 27
28 #define TK_LSHIFT 28
29 #define TK_RSHIFT 29
30 #define TK_PLUS 30
31 #define TK_MINUS 31
32 #define TK_STAR 32
33 #define TK_SLASH 33
34 #define TK_REM 34
35 #define TK_CONCAT 35
36 #define TK_PTR 36
37 #define TK_COLLATE 37
38 #define TK_BITNOT 38
39 #define TK_ON 39
40 #define TK_ID 40
41 #define TK_ABORT 41
42 #define TK_ACTION 42
43 #define TK_AFTER 43
44 #define TK_ANALYZE 44
45 #define TK_ASC 45
46 #define TK_ATTACH 46
47 #define TK_BEFORE 47
48 #define TK_BEGIN 48
49 #define TK_BY 49
50 #define TK_CASCADE 50
51 #define TK_CAST 51
52 #define TK_COLUMNKW 52
53 #define TK_CONFLICT 53
54 #define TK_DATABASE 54
55 #define TK_DEFERRED 55
56 #define TK_DESC 56
57 #define TK_DETACH 57
58 #define TK_DO 58
59 #define TK_EACH 59
60 #define TK_END 60
61 #define TK_EXCLUSIVE 61
62 #define TK_EXPLAIN 62
63 #define TK_FAIL 63
64 #define TK_FOR 64
65 #define TK_IGNORE 65
66 #define TK_IMMEDIATE 66
67 #define TK_INITIALLY 67
68 #define TK_INSTEAD 68
69 #define TK_NO 69
70 #define TK_PLAN 70
71 #define TK_QUERY 71
72 #define TK_KEY 72
73 #define TK_OF 73
74 #define TK_OFFSET 74
75 #define TK_PRAGMA 75
76 #define TK_RAISE 76
77 #define TK_RECURSIVE 77
78 #define TK_RELEASE 78
79 #define TK_RESTRICT 79
80 #define TK_ROW 80
81 #define TK_ROWS 81
82 #define TK_ROLLBACK 82
83 #define TK_SAVEPOINT 83
84 #define TK_TEMP 84
85 #define TK_TRIGGER 85
86 #define TK_VACUUM 86
87 #define TK_VIEW 87
88 #define TK_VIRTUAL 88
89 #define TK_WITH 89
90 #define TK_WITHOUT 90
91 #define TK_NULLS 91
92 #define TK_FIRST 92
93 #define TK_LAST 93
94 #define TK_EXCEPT 94
95 #define TK_INTERSECT 95
96 #define TK_UNION 96
97 #define TK_CURRENT 97
98 #define TK_FOLLOWING 98
99 #define TK_PARTITION 99
100 #define TK_PRECEDING 100
101 #define TK_RANGE 101
102 #define TK_UNBOUNDED 102
103 #define TK_EXCLUDE 103
104 #define TK_GROUPS 104
105 #define TK_OTHERS 105
106 #define TK_TIES 106
107 #define TK_WITHIN 107
108 #define TK_GENERATED 108
109 #define TK_ALWAYS 109
110 #define TK_MATERIALIZED 110
111 #define TK_REINDEX 111
112 #define TK_RENAME 112
113 #define TK_CTIME_KW 113
114 #define TK_IF 114
115 #define TK_ANY 115
116 #define TK_COMMIT 116
117 #define TK_TO 117
118 #define TK_TABLE 118
119 #define TK_EXISTS 119
120 #define TK_LP 120
121 #define TK_RP 121
122 #define TK_AS 122
123 #define TK_COMMA 123
124 #define TK_STRING 124
125 #define TK_CONSTRAINT 125
126 #define TK_DEFAULT 126
127 #define TK_INDEXED 127
128 #define TK_NULL 128
129 #define TK_PRIMARY 129
130 #define TK_UNIQUE 130
131 #define TK_CHECK 131
132 #define TK_REFERENCES 132
133 #define TK_AUTOINCR 133
134 #define TK_INSERT 134
135 #define TK_DELETE 135
136 #define TK_UPDATE 136
137 #define TK_SET 137
138 #define TK_DEFERRABLE 138
139 #define TK_FOREIGN 139
140 #define TK_DROP 140
141 #define TK_ALL 141
142 #define TK_SELECT 142
143 #define TK_VALUES 143
144 #define TK_DISTINCT 144
145 #define TK_DOT 145
146 #define TK_FROM 146
147 #define TK_JOIN 147
148 #define TK_JOIN_KW 148
149 #define TK_USING 149
150 #define TK_ORDER 150
151 #define TK_GROUP 151
152 #define TK_HAVING 152
153 #define TK_LIMIT 153
154 #define TK_WHERE 154
155 #define TK_RETURNING 155
156 #define TK_INTO 156
157 #define TK_NOTHING 157
158 #define TK_FLOAT 158
159 #define TK_BLOB 159
160 #define TK_INTEGER 160
161 #define TK_VARIABLE 161
162 #define TK_CASE 162
163 #define TK_WHEN 163
164 #define TK_THEN 164
165 #define TK_ELSE 165
166 #define TK_INDEX 166
167 #define TK_SEMI 167
168 #define TK_ALTER 168
169 #define TK_ADD 169
170 #define TK_WINDOW 170
171 #define TK_OVER 171
172 #define TK_FILTER 172
173 #define TK_TRANSACTION 173
174 #define TK_SPACE 174
175 #define TK_ILLEGAL 175
176